JOB D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ES:

• Direct and manage or work with cabling crews
• Build out telecommunications closets
• Install cable support systems which consist of cable tray, j-hooks and ladder tray
• Install cat 6 horizontal station cable, backbone cable, fiber optic cable and inner duct
• Install special systems, security, CCTV, audio visual, and fire alarm cable
• Terminate cat 6 horizontal 4-pair work-area outlet (modular connector) and optical fiber (multi-mode, single-mode, LC, SC)
• Perform copper splicing, fiber splicing (fusion or mechanical)
• Perform copper cable testing (UTP and coax) and optical fiber testing
• Perform both copper and optical fiber troubleshooting
• Must be able to work on ladders and use power tools
• Must have the ability to lift, carry, and set up a 50 lb. ladder
• Ability to work overtime as needed
• Ability to work under pressure and meet deadlines

Requirements

• OSHA 10 required

• 5+_ years’ experience in the communications cabling Industry

• Data Center experience a PLUS
• Demonstrate a clear knowledge of codes and standards
• Ability to complete and submit accurate documentation which tracks work progress including timesheets and other related documents
• Communicate with strong written and verbal skills
• Maintain a positive attitude and professional dress and demeanor

TOOLS:
Owns all company required communications technician hand tools, keeps them in good operating condition, and knows how to use them.

CERTIFICATION (desired):
• BICSI Certified Technician -- Installer 1 or 2, Copper and/or Fiber
• Other manufacturer certifications
• Other certifications such as Confined Space, etc.
